Lorelei 

Too much, too much.

I cannot see for seeing so much of you.

You are the heart of a precious stone

Where I’ve gazed too long

And cannot look away.

Things that call for my attention

Go unheeded.

Things that I must do 

Lie by the roadside, undone

For my need of seeing you.

You are too much, too much

To be absorbed or taken in

By these eyes.

I am addicted to the sight of you

And see the image of you

In all the things before me.

You have blinded me with

Your distracting beauty
